A member of the Lake Dick Cooperative Association repairs a mowing machine in Lake Dick, Arkansas, in September 1938. The cooperative was part of a movement that supported farmers through shared resources and labor. This image provides insight into the agricultural practices of the era, emphasizing community collaboration in rural areas.
